A regional social services organization is looking for a Family Time Worker in Northumberland. This role involves supervising family time sessions for vulnerable families and children, while maintaining professional relationships and managing behaviours.

Candidates should have a minimum NVQ 3 in a related field and experience working with children and families.

The position offers 26 days of leave plus public holidays, access to a pension scheme, and a flexible working scheme.

How to prepare for a job interview at Northumberland Fire Group

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you’re familiar with the role of a Family Time Specialist. Brush up on your knowledge about child development, family dynamics, and safeguarding practices.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you’re genuinely interested in supporting families.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past work with children and families. Think about situations where you’ve successfully managed behaviours or built professional relationships.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ses clearly.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are some insightful questions about the organisation’s approach to family time sessions and how they support their staff. This shows you’re engaged and serious about the role, plus it helps you determine if it’s the right fit for you.

✨Be Yourself

Authenticity goes a long way in interviews. Be honest about your motivations for wanting to work as a Family Time Specialist and how you can contribute to the team. Remember, they’re looking for someone who fits well with their values and culture, so let your personality shine through!
